5 Reasons Galloway Creek Greenway is THE BEST Trail in Springfield, Mo 

 March 31, 2021

By  Carla Broderick

There are so many beautiful trails to explore in 417 land!

When the weather is nice, one of my absolute favorite trails to hit is Galloway Creek Greenway

And I don’t think I’m the only one to think that since Galloway Creek Greenway is the first trail in Missouri to be designated a National Recreation Trail.

The Contrast of Scenery

galloway creek greenway scenery

You get a bit of everything while you’re strolling, or rolling, along the Galloway Creek Greenway. 

Being surrounded by nature and forgetting you’re in the middle of the city? Check

Urban feel as you follow the trail under and over major roads and railways? You got it. 

A beautiful park with a cave, pond, and waterfall? Yup

Passing right by the pet cemetery for all you weirdos out there?  Absolutely. 

Gorgeous view of the James River? Right on this trail.

Sequiota Park

sequiota greenway trail

Galloway trail runs right by the lovely Sequiota Park.

Take a quick pit stop and enjoy the multiple playgrounds, the huge rocks leading to the cave, the rolling stream, and the peaceful little waterfalls.

And if you’re lucky, you might even get to visit with the geese that frequent the pond in the center of the park. 

Galloway Village 

galloway village greenway trail

Just a few minutes down the trail from the park lies a historic spot that used to be a popular stop on the Gulf Line Railway in the late 1800s.

Even though the area has evolved over the years, Galloway Village still remains a sought-after area to visit. 

You’ll be immersed in Springfield’s midwestern hospitality as you peruse shops, grab a bite to eat or grab a local brew, all in Galloway Village.  

If you want to take an even longer break from the trail, you can stop in at Acacia Spa for true rest or go over and get your creative juices flowing at Firehouse Pottery.

Paved the Whole Way

paved galloway creek greenway

Ok, so this might not be what everyone is looking for if you want to get that adventurous off-the-beaten-path feel.

But having five miles of paved trail is great for when you just want a relaxing bike or walk to enjoy all around you. 

It makes for smooth riding and easy strollin
